Brief Explanations:

The electrical force between two objects is given by Coulomb's law $F = k\frac{q_1q_2}{r^2}$, where $q_1$ and $q_2$ are the charges of the two - objects and $r$ is the distance between them. Mass and electric - field strength are not part of this formula for the direct electrical force between two point - charges.
